C-515/10 European Commission v French Republic Date Déc 1, 2011 Source UNEP, InforMEA Nom du tribunal CJEU - Judgment of the Court (Eighth Chamber) of 1 December 2011 Résumé Judgment of the Court (Eighth Chamber) of 1 December 2011 –Commission v France (Case C-515/10) Failure of a Member State to fulfil obligations – Directive 1999/31/EC – Decision 2003/33/EC – National legislation – Landfill for inert waste – Acceptance of asbestos-cement waste Environment – Waste – Landfill of waste – Directive 1999/31 – National legislation providing for the treatment of asbestos-cement waste in landfills for inert waste – Failure to fulfil obligations (Art. 258 TFEU; Council Directive 1999/31, Arts 2(e), 3(1), 6(d) and 16, and Annex II; Council Decision 2003/33, Annex) (see paras 25-26, 28, operative part) Re: Operative part The Court: 1. Declares that, by failing to adopt the laws, regulations and administrative provisions necessary to ensure that asbestos-cement waste is treated in suitable landfills, the French Republic has failed to fulfil its obligations under Article 2(e), the first subparagraph of Article 3 and Article 6(d) of Council Directive 1999/31/EC of 26 April 1999 on the landfill of waste and the provisions of the Annex to Council Decision 2003/33/EC of 19 December 2002 establishing criteria and procedures for the acceptance of waste at landfills pursuant to Article 16 of and Annex II to Directive 1999/31; 2. Orders the French Republic to pay the costs. Texte intégral eur-lex.europa.eu
